Why Choose a Career as a CNA?
The role of a CNA is crucial in the healthcare system. Here are some compelling reasons to pursue this career:
- High Demand: The healthcare industry is growing, with an increasing need for CNAs.
- Job Satisfaction: Helping patients improve their quality of life can be incredibly rewarding.
- Flexible Schedules: Many CNA positions offer flexible hours, making it easy to balance work and personal life.
- career Advancement: Starting as a CNA can lead to more advanced positions in nursing and healthcare.

Benefits of CNA Classes
Enrolling in CNA classes provides numerous benefits, including:
- Hands-on Experience: Most programs offer clinical practice, helping you gain real-world skills.
- Knowledge Acquisition: You’ll learn about patient care, infection control, and dialog skills.
- Networking Opportunities: Connect with professionals and peers to enhance your career prospects.
